Core Components
Application Server
At the centre of any application infrastructure lies the application server. This critical component is tasked with storing and executing the core business and application logic necessary for the application’s operation. The application server works alongside web servers and database servers to process requests and deliver services efficiently. By providing redundancy and security, it ensures that distributed applications are effectively managed and hosted.
Web Server
Integral to the infrastructure is the web server, which facilitates user interaction with applications via the HTTP protocol. It hosts the graphical interface, crucial for user experience, and is often a subset of the application server, optimising both static and dynamic content requests. The efficiency of web servers directly impacts the user engagement and satisfaction levels.
Security Measures
In today’s digital realm, security is non-negotiable. Firewalls, including web application firewalls (WAFs) and reverse proxies, form the first line of defence against unauthorised access. By enforcing strict security policies, they protect on-premises and cloud applications from malware and cyber threats, such as broken access control and cross-site scripting. Intrusion detection systems (IDS) further enhance security by monitoring web traffic for malicious patterns and quickly alerting administrators to potential threats.
Storage Servers
The data layer of application infrastructure relies heavily on storage servers. These servers manage and store critical information, using SQL Server instances for relational data and file servers for data stored in files. Efficient data management ensures that user requests are fulfilled promptly, maintaining the performance and reliability of applications.
In-House vs. Outsourcing
Organisations face a pivotal choice between building their application infrastructure in-house or outsourcing it to third-party cloud providers. Building in-house allows for greater control and customisation, catering specifically to the unique needs of the business. However, this approach demands substantial resources and expertise. Conversely, outsourcing offers scalability and cost-effectiveness, along with access to the vendor’s proficiency in managing the underlying computing hardware. “Choosing between in-house and outsourcing involves balancing control and flexibility,” notes Alice Turner, CIO of Global Tech Solutions.
Detailed Analysis
The decision to build or outsource application infrastructure is more than a technical choice; it reflects broader economic and strategic trends. As businesses strive for agility and cost efficiency, the allure of cloud solutions grows. Cloud vendors provide an attractive proposition with pay-as-you-go models and scalability options, enabling businesses to adapt quickly to market changes without hefty capital investment.
However, for industries where compliance, data sovereignty, and security are paramount, in-house solutions offer unmatched control and customisation. The choice also mirrors the organisation’s maturity, with startups more likely to opt for cloud solutions to minimise upfront costs, while established enterprises may invest in in-house infrastructure to leverage existing capabilities.
